In case of DC voltage for supplying of contactors, installation of suppression 2A/600V diodes directly
at contactors´s coils is strongly recommended. Furthermore, note lower maximum current load of the
controller outputs at such case ( see technical parameters table).
2.2.5.3 Novar 10xx Controllers
The Novar1005 and Novar1007 relays’ contacts go to terminals 5 through 12. The relays’ common
contacts are internally connected to power supply terminal
L
( No. 4 )
At the Novar1005D and Novar1007D models, the relays’ contacts go to terminals 20 through 27. The
relays’ common contacts are connected to additional terminal
RC
( No. 19 ), that is isolated from
power supply terminals.

2.2.6 Second Metering Rate, External Alarm
In some situations it may be suitable to operate the controller with two different settings, for example
depending on load characteristics in different daily or weekly zones. To select the setting desired,
there is the second metering rate input.
WARNING !!! This input is not galvanically isolated from the controller’s internal circuitry and
its terminals constitute exposure to hazardous voltage against the ground potential!
It is
therefore necessary for the relay, switch or optocoupler, driving the input, to be isolated (no external
voltage) and to be located as close to the controller as possible (optimally in the same cabinet) to
minimize the lead length (maximum about 2 to 3 metres). The input is connected to terminals 11 and
12. The input’s internal power supply voltage is about 30 V DC, switching current about 5 mA.
If the second metering rate active device is a transistor (NPN) or optocoupler, it is necessary to
observe the connection polarity – transistor or optocoupler collector to go to terminal
+
(11) and
emitter to terminal
–
(12).
When the input is open, the controller operates with the basic metering rate setting, when it is closed
(if the second metering rate function is enabled – see further below), it operates with the second
metering rate setting.
If second metering rate function is switched off, the second metering rate input can be used for
external alarm signal – see description of parameters 30, 40.
Only 12xx and 13xx line controllers feature the second metering rate selection input.
2.2.7 Communication Interface
The controllers can be equipped with galvanically isolated communication interface in compliance with
RS-485 or Ethernet specification for remote setup and control process monitoring.
